A motorcycle courier in his mid-twenties is asked to drive the 16-year-old daughter of a smuggler. They fall in love, but when she figures out that he is kidnapping her for a ransom, she jumps into the river, and he is jailed for murder. After his release he meets a dancer: her alter ego.

- Director: Lou Ye
- Principal Cast: Xun Zhou, Hongsheng Jia, Zhongkai Hua, Anlian Yao, Nai An
- Country: China
- Year: 2000
- Running Time: 83 min.
- Language: Chinese
- Has Subtitles: Yes
